Dear all,
I encountered a problem while meshing a geometry using StarCCM+. I have a geometry that I enclosed in a sphere, and further, I enclosed this complete set-up into a cylinder. The meshing on geometry is fine but moving away from geometry the size of the cell is increasing in my case (which is still okay, but) I need a gradual increase in the size of the cell (attached file). Furthermore, the meshing on extreme outer domain i.e cylinder is completely fine. Is there any way to control the size of cells so that the size of cells increase gradually/progressively? There should be growth rate and/or max cell size options in the meshers you can configure. If that doesn't get the job done then maybe an unstructured mesh isn't really what you want and you will need to consider importing a mesh from something that can do structured mesh.

Otherwise trimmed mes, polyhedral mesh does't have maximum cell size function in mesh continua.
you should control that using surface size, volume comtrol and growth rate only. |
